WebAug 18, 2024 · Public high school education in Korea is fairly affordable. Most kids pay between $1,000 to $1,500 USD to attend each year. Since high school is only for 3 years in Korea, most students will pay between $3,000 to $4,500 for admission fees for public education. To kids from the US, this may seem like a high price for high school.
